Output 5e944ab9c0ec50638ba7d5f29e3c0add9102c373e960c24ecf161156b2af26f0:1

value
2886350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ace17ff46a358e68f1b1e0dfe8fcf944a8482d OP_EQUAL
address
3EszL959NMqgt9fq4oJtN1hrEPzqQbkNVn
transaction
5e944ab9c0ec50638ba7d5f29e3c0add9102c373e960c24ecf161156b2af26f0
confirmations
325104
spent
true